THE WAR IN MANCHURIA.
RUSSIANS ON THE OFFENSIVE. LONDON, April 6. The Russjicns on Tuesday were assuming the offensive. They; lirst bombarded Chinchentun. A large infantry force, supported by two flanking columns, simultanjeously advaneed within 400 metres of the Japanese position, but the ( j attack was completely repulsed after ■ a sharp conflict. The Japanese casualties were 27, and the Russians 200. ] t 1
